Concrete Slab Water Extraction Cost in Derry, NH

The cost of Concrete Slab Water Extraction in Derry, NH, var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ates range from $500 to $2,500 or more, depending on the complexity of the job.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Small water leak extraction $500-$1,500 Size of affected area, type of equipment used
Standing water extraction $1,000-$3,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ment used, drying time
Water damage cleanup $1,500-$4,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ment used, level of contamination
Concrete slab drying $1,000-$3,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ment used, drying time
Water damage restoration $2,000-$5,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ment used, level of contamination, drying time

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ates to ensure you know exactly what to expect.

Q: Can I prevent water damage to my concrete slab?

A: Yes, you can prevent water damage to your concrete slab by installing a French drain, sealing cracks and joints, and keeping the area around the slab clear of debris.
